What Triggers Error 255?

Before diving into solutions, understanding what Error 255 *is* is crucial. This error doesn’t always point to a single, specific problem. Instead, it serves as a general-purpose notification, indicating that a process has failed or encountered an issue that it couldn’t resolve. The “255” code often represents an exit code from a program or a command line instruction, signaling an error. This means the program, script, or command encountered a problem during its execution.

Where Error 255 Surfaces

The triggers for this error are incredibly diverse, making pinpointing the root cause the first challenge. However, several common culprits tend to appear again and again:

  • **File Permission Challenges:** This is a frequent offender. If a program lacks the necessary permissions to access a file, write to a directory, or execute a specific action, Error 255 can quickly arise. Imagine a program trying to read a configuration file but not having the rights to do so; the outcome is a clear indication of the error.
  • **Network Connection Headaches:** Error 255 can also surface because of network connectivity problems. Issues like a disrupted internet connection, DNS resolution failures, or restrictions from firewalls can block a program’s ability to function as expected. This can be especially true when dealing with applications reliant on cloud services or network drives.
  • **Corrupted or Missing Files:** The absence of essential files or the presence of corrupt ones will throw off any software program. Missing libraries, damaged configuration files, or broken executable files will invariably trigger Error 255.
  • **Software Conflicts:** Conflicts between different pieces of software are unfortunately common. Sometimes, installed programs or the operating system itself may have incompatible versions, resulting in conflicts that lead to the error code.
  • **Hardware Issues:** Although less common, hardware problems can play a role. Disk errors, memory issues, or even problems with peripherals can manifest as Error 255, particularly if they affect file access or system operations.
  • **Operating System Instability:** An outdated, corrupted, or malfunctioning operating system is a potential source of this error. Operating system problems can hinder processes from executing correctly, thereby causing failures and the related error message.
  • **Incompatibility Issues:** Ensure software and hardware components are compatible with your system. Older software might fail if the operating system has upgraded.

Investigating File Permissions

Incorrect file permissions are common culprits behind Error 255. The operating system uses file permissions to control which users and programs can access files and directories. Here’s how to check and modify permissions:

  • **Windows:**
    • Right-click the problematic file or folder.
    • Select “Properties”.
    • Go to the “Security” tab.
    • Check the permissions for your user account. Make sure you have the required permissions: at a minimum, “Read” and “Execute” permissions, and often, “Write” access.
    • If necessary, click “Edit” and adjust permissions as needed. Then apply your changes.
  • **macOS:**
    • Select the file or folder.
    • Choose “Get Info” from the “File” menu.
    • In the “Sharing & Permissions” section, check the permissions for your user account. You will want Read & Write access.
    • If necessary, click the lock icon at the bottom and enter your administrator password to make changes.
    • Adjust permissions as needed and close the window.
  • **Linux:**
    • Open a terminal.
    • Use the `ls -l` command to view file permissions.
    • Use the `chmod` command to change permissions. For example, `chmod 755 filename` grants read, write, and execute permissions to the owner, and read and execute permissions to the group and others.
    • Use the `chown` command to change the file owner. For example, `chown username:groupname filename` changes the owner and group of the file.

Always be careful when altering permissions. Incorrectly set permissions can compromise the security and functionality of your system.

Running as Administrator/Root

Sometimes, an application needs elevated privileges to work correctly.

  • **Windows:** Right-click the application’s icon or executable file and select “Run as administrator”. This gives the application all the necessary permissions.
  • **macOS/Linux:** Use the `sudo` command (Linux/macOS) in the terminal. For example, `sudo ./application_name`. On macOS, you can often right-click the application and choose “Show Package Contents” to find the executable and run it. Running the app directly or through the Terminal allows you elevated privileges. Be cautious when using `sudo`, and only do so if necessary and when you understand what the command is doing.

Error 255 During Script Execution

When Error 255 arises when executing a script, the problem is usually within the script itself. This means the errors are often found in syntax, missing dependencies, and file permissions.

  • **Review the Script:** Carefully examine the script’s code.
    • **Syntax:** Check for typos, incorrect punctuation, and other syntax errors. Many text editors will highlight syntax problems.
    • **Dependencies:** Verify that all necessary libraries or modules are installed. If your script requires Python, ensure Python is installed on your system and that the required packages are installed with `pip install`.
    • **File Paths:** Double-check file paths used within the script. Incorrect or relative paths can lead to errors.
    • **Permissions:** Ensure the script has execute permissions (e.g., use `chmod +x script_name` in Linux/macOS).
  • **Debugging:** Use debugging tools specific to the scripting language. Most languages have debuggers that allow you to step through the code line by line, inspect variables, and identify the exact point of failure.
  • **Error Messages:** Examine the error messages carefully. These messages give specific clues about what went wrong (e.g., “file not found,” “permission denied,” “module not found”). The message should pinpoint the area of code containing the problem.

Error 255 While Installing Software

During software installations, this error often stems from insufficient access to installation locations, or perhaps, compatibility issues, among other things.

  • **Verify Installation Prerequisites:**
    • Some programs require specific versions of .NET Framework, Java Runtime Environment (JRE), or other software. Make sure you’ve installed all the requirements.
  • **Check Disk Space:** Ensure there’s enough free space on your hard drive.
  • **Temporarily Disable Security Software:**
    • Security software (firewalls or antivirus) can sometimes block installations. Temporarily disable it (and remember to re-enable it immediately afterward).
  • **Run the Installer as Administrator:**
    • As mentioned before, grant the installer elevated permissions.
  • **Check Installation Logs:**
    • Most installers generate log files that record the installation process. These logs can provide detailed information about any errors encountered.

Error 255 on a Web Server

Web server errors often come from problems with web server configuration.

  • **Review Server Configuration:**
    • Examine your web server’s configuration files (e.g., Apache’s `httpd.conf` or Nginx’s `nginx.conf`).
    • Verify that file paths, virtual host settings, and other configurations are correct.
  • **Check Server Logs:**
    • Web server logs record all activity. Look for error messages that point to the source of the problem (e.g., “file not found,” “permission denied,” “internal server error”). These logs are essential for finding and addressing problems quickly.
  • **Permissions on Web Files:**
    • Ensure the web server process has the correct permissions to access web files and directories. Usually, the web server user (e.g., `www-data` on Debian/Ubuntu) needs read access to files and execute access to scripts.
  • **Test Your Script:**
    • If you are using a scripting language such as PHP or Python, test the script. Incorrect syntax, file paths, or missing libraries could trigger the error.

    Analyzing and Repairing Drives

    If the basic steps don’t work, you might need to dig a little deeper.

    Disk errors can occasionally cause Error 255.

    • **Checking the Drive’s Health:**
      • *Windows:* Use the `chkdsk` command (check disk) in the command prompt. Run the command `chkdsk /f /r C:` (replace C: with the drive letter).
      • *macOS:* Use Disk Utility to verify and repair the disk. You can find it in the Applications -> Utilities folder.
      • *Linux:* Use the `fsck` command in the terminal to check the file system.

    Analyzing System Logs

    System logs record events that occur on your system. Analyzing these logs can offer valuable clues to the source of Error 255.

    • **Locating the Logs:**
      • *Windows:* The Event Viewer (search for “Event Viewer” in the Start menu) contains system, application, and security logs.
      • *macOS:* Console.app (located in the Utilities folder) shows console messages and system logs.
      • *Linux:* Logs are typically in the `/var/log` directory (e.g., `/var/log/syslog`, `/var/log/auth.log`, etc.).
    • **Interpreting the Logs:**
      • Look for error messages, warnings, and other anomalies that occur around the time Error 255 appears.
